The video tutorial guides students on how to craft thoughtful endings for narratives. It uses the example of Freya, a girl who wants a cat, to illustrate how to construct a satisfying conclusion. The tutorial emphasizes the importance of tying up loose ends and reflecting on the story's events. It explores different possible endings for Freya's story, demonstrating how each can be meaningful. Students are encouraged to practice writing their own conclusions, focusing on explaining and reflecting on the story's events.
